Testing your anti-bot systems under controlled conditions is crucial to ensure they work effectively without blocking legitimate players. A typical approach involves simulating bot-like behavior (rapid joining/leaving, ping flooding) from test clients while observing how your defenses respond—verify that rate limits kick in, captchas appear, and IPs get temporarily banned without affecting real players. The key is to run these tests on your own infrastructure with explicit permission, as unauthorized testing against other servers is illegal and unethical.

Consumer routers’ built-in “DDoS protection” cannot handle even a 1 Gbps botnet attack. Attackers easily saturate home internet upload speeds.

While Cloudflare's standard free tier focuses on HTTP web traffic, advanced users can utilize tools like (which has paid tiers) or free reverse-proxy alternatives (like TCPSHIELD's free tier) specifically designed for Minecraft. These services hide your backend server's true IP address and filter out malicious bot traffic at the edge of their global networks. Conclusion
